> > -   mutex_lock(&workqueue_mutex);
> > +   preempt_disable();              /* CPU hotplug */
> >     for_each_online_cpu(cpu) {
> >             INIT_WORK(per_cpu_ptr(works, cpu), func);
> >             __queue_work(per_cpu_ptr(keventd_wq->cpu_wq, cpu),
> >                             per_cpu_ptr(works, cpu));
> >     }
> > -   mutex_unlock(&workqueue_mutex);
> > +   preempt_enable();
> 
> Why not cpu_hotplug_lock()?
> 

Because the workqueue code was explicitly switched over to per-subsystem
cpu-hotplug locking.

Because lock_cpu_hotplug() is a complete turkey, source of deadlocks and
overall bad idea.

This is actually a pretty simple problem.  A subsystem has per-cpu reosurces,
and it needs to lock them while using them.  duh.  We know how to do that
sort of thing.  But because the first implementation of lock_cpu_hotplug()
was conceived with magical properties, we seem to think we need to retain
magical properties.  We don't...
